                                                                      IMAGINE INTERVIEWING for the position of UCD specialist in a company that uses
                                                                      an agile software development process. Could you answer questions such as, “how
                                                                      does UCD fit in an agile process?”
                                                                          UCD specialists may be horrified when they first hear about agile methods [1].
                                                                      Agile literature emphasizes developers delivering production code quickly rather per-
                                                                      forming extensive analysis and design (e.g., UCD) prior to coding. However, the agile
                                                                      literature indicates that this perception is simplistic and misguided. Examining pro-
                                                                      fessional practice, as we do in this article, paints a different picture of how UCD and
                                                                      agile practices coexist in a development team.


                                                                      INTRODUCTION TO AGILE METHODS. The agile approach is quickly becoming
                                                                      mainstream in the software industry. The agile community is defined by a core set of
                                                                      beliefs and practices. The most well-known articulation of agile beliefs is the
                                                                      Manifesto for Agile Software Development (www.agilemanifesto.org), which states:
                                                                          “...we have come to value:
                                                                                 • Individuals and interactions over processes and tools
                                                                                 • Working software over comprehensive documentation
                                                                                 • Customer collaboration over contract negotiation
                                                                                 • Responding to change over following a plan
                                                                          ...”
                                                                          The most widely used agile approaches are Extreme Programming [2] and
                                                                      Scrum [5]. Information about others (including Adaptive Software Development,
                                                                      Agile Software Development, DSDM, Lean Software Development, Feature-Driven
                                                                      Development, Agile Modeling) can readily be found on the Internet.
                                                                          The following paragraph highlights the interactions occurring in an idealized
                                                                      agile team by providing a glimpse into a typical flow of work. Italicized terms are key
                                                                      agile terms.
                                                                          At the beginning of an iteration (or Scrum Sprint), members of the team sit down
                                                                      with their on-site customer representative(s) to discuss what features they’d like
                                                                      included in their application. While a bit ambiguous in the agile lingo, customers
                                                                      include anyone who has a stake in the development project (including clients and
                                                                      users). Customer requests are captured as user stories on index cards. A user story is
                                                                      a description of a feature of the software system that has business value in the eyes
                                                                      of the customer representatives. User stories play a similar role to use cases, scenar-

                                                          In the following, we’ll discuss how UCD specialists found their role in agile envi-
                                                     ronments.


                                                     INTRODUCTION TO THE CASE STUDY. The authors interviewed three UCD spe-
                                                     cialists who were working on their first agile project. They all have degrees with a
                                                     UCD/HCI specialization and prior UCD experience.

                                                              • TB works on medical instrumentation products using the Industrial XP
                                                                methodology.

                                                              • MG’s project involves replacing a character-based UI to a supply-chain-
                                                                planning product. The company uses an agile approach developed in-
                                                                house.

                                                              • PV is an independent consultant whose client is a start-up company
                                                                developing tools to support agile development. The company uses an
                                                                agile approach developed in-house.

                                                          The remainder of this article compares agile literature to the case studies under
                                                     following headings: making the case for UCD, understanding users, UI design, and
                                                     evaluating design usability.


                                                     MAKING THE CASE FOR UCD. Like other development methods, the agile litera-
                                                     ture does not identify a distinct UCD role, so the onus remains on UCD to justify and
                                                     define its role on the team. Table 1 shows common UCD claims and how they might
                                                     be countered by someone familiar with agile literature.

                                                          While the preceding table paints a depressing picture, our case studies told a dif-
                                                     ferent story.

                                                              • TB: His company’s centralized UCD group supported a proposal to pilot
                                                                agile methods and dedicated TB to the pilot team. TB’s UCD role is part of
                                                                the product management team, which includes product managers,

domain experts, a technical writer, and two testers. As part of the “every-
                                   one pitch in” ethos of agile projects, TB helps write acceptance tests, and
                                   other product management team members help run usability tests.

                                  • MG: MG’s company has a centralized UCD group with an executive
                                   leader. That leader mandated that UCD staff be routinely included on proj-
                                   ects. Receptivity to this directive varies. MG supports two teams; the team
                                   discussed in this article was receptive. Compared to non-agile projects,
                                   timesharing is more difficult. MG has not experienced much blurring of
                                   her UCD role.

                                  • PV: PV is an independent consultant whose client is a start-up company.
                                   The company founder sought UCD skills because of an exposure to UCD
                                   at a prior company. PV works mostly remotely and uses instant messag-
                                   ing. In addition to his traditional UCD duties, he helps solve technical Web
                                   development issues.


                          UNDERSTANDING USERS. This section examines understanding users as an
                          input to subsequent design activities. The agile literature perspective can be charac-
                          terized by the following points:

                                  • Favors developers working directly with customer representative(s) to
                                   understand requirements.

                                  • Based on developer recommendations, customer representatives make
                                   final decisions on how the system should behave.

                                  • Complete only a preliminary analysis before beginning coding and clarify
                                   customer needs as questions arise during the coding.

                              Our practitioners encountered practices described above but also experienced
                          significant deviations. They reported that the “customer representative” was often an
                          employee of the software vendor. This person could be a domain expert, a former
                          employee of the customer, or someone responsible for product direction. Our prac-
                          titioners often found they were able to extend agile practices with traditional UCD
                          approaches, including personas. As well, UCD was able to undertake significant “up-
                          front analysis and UI design.” Here are some specific experiences:

                                  • TB: By coincidence, UCD had completed contextual enquiry and personas
                                   before the agile project was launched. TB recommends this up-front
                                   analysis prior to project start-up.

                                  • MG: Inclusion of UCD in writing customer stories is variable.


                          UI DESIGN. The agile literature suggests UCD UI design practices need adjustment,
                          as shown in Table 2.
                              Our case study participants confirmed that their UI design practices required
                          adjustments, especially to adapt to iterative development. They gave the following
                          examples of the scope of UI design addressed in a single story:

                                                           Here are some specific experiences:

                                                               • TB: TB’s team conducts empirical testing with real users at least once for
                                                                 every internal release (three months). Little usability testing is done per
                                                                 iteration. They use paired observers for tests, adapting the pair program-
                                                                 ming practice. Originally, they had trouble getting design changes made,
                                                                 but recently, the team decided to devote two weeks from every internal
                                                                 release to making changes resulting from usability testing. Sometimes
                                                                 they conduct informal usability testing in the programming area with the
                                                                 latest code, which engages the interest of programmers working nearby.

                                                               • MG: Her testing is similar to non-agile projects. However, testing is
                                                                 focused on feeding changes into the next project plan (as opposed to fix-
                                                                 ing this release).

                                                               • PV: Usability testing is informally done every few iterations. Testing might
                                                                 involve showing customers or customer proxies prototypes. The pace and
                                                                 timeframe of iterations makes testing more difficult than in non-agile
                                                                 projects. He is still working on convincing the project sponsor to spend
                                                                 time on more testing.


                                                      CONCLUSIONS. Agile methods have a distinctive development culture that, at first
                                                      glance, seems not to be hospitable to UCD. However, all our UCD practitioner reports
                                                      were positive. Certainly, work-life aspects were positive-they felt actively engaged in
                                                      a common goal. Our participants said the resulting UI designs may or may not be bet-
                                                      ter but are certainly no worse. These case studies can be seen as interim reports:
                                                      Agile methods are still maturing, and no case study participant had yet shipped their
                                                      first agile project. To keep informed about recent discussions, visit the Yahoo discus-
                                                      sion group called “Agile Usability” [4].
